I’ve been rewatching “House” recently and feel similarly to you. The comparison to Sheldon makes sense, but their “honesty” is born of very different natures. Both are written a little too extreme for my taste, but i relate to House more. Sheldon is just completely aloof and operates on a matter of fact setting. House is aware that some of the things he says and does are nothing short of vicious, but he does it anyway. Likely as a result of a compulsion to drive people away because he thinks he doesn’t truly deserve to be happy. There are at least two episodes in which he flat out states that his happiness interferes with his skill and ability to do what he does as well as he does it.
I personally hold honesty in very high regard but reject “radical honesty”, and i’m not oblivious to how my words and actions effect others.
